About John B. Walker

John B. Walker is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Hematology, Surgery, Cancer Research and Molecular Biology, having authored 21 papers that have together received 1.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Blood properties and coagulation (8 papers), Blood Coagulation and Thrombosis Mechanisms (8 papers), Protease and Inhibitor Mechanisms (4 papers), Music Therapy and Health (2 papers), Abdominal vascular conditions and treatments (2 papers), Periodontal Regeneration and Treatments (1 paper), Protein purification and stability (1 paper) and Hemophilia Treatment and Research (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Hematology (473 citations), Psychiatry and Mental health (419 citations), Internal Medicine (86 citations), Experimental and Cognitive Psychology (207 citations) and Cognitive Neuroscience (275 citations). John B. Walker has collaborated with scholars based in Canada, United States and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include P. J. Moberg, Christian G. Kohler, Kristin M. Healey, Elizabeth A. Martin, Michael E. Nesheim, Laszlo Bajzar, Michael B. Boffa, Wei Wang, John A. Samis and Alan R. Giles.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Journal of Thrombosis and Haemostasis, Blood, Journal of Orthopaedic Trauma and Schizophrenia Bulletin.
